Umm Al Salsal Trading Flowers and Indoor Plants
Umm Al Salsal Trading Flowers and Indoor Plants
Address: Shop No 31/32 , Abu Dhabi. See full address and map.
Categories: Plants - Indoor
Wonderful Plants
Wonderful Plants
Address: Abu Dhabi, Abu Dhabi. See full address and map.
Categories: Plants - Indoor
Damanhoor for Plants & Herbs
Damanhoor for Plants & Herbs
Address: Abu Dhabi, Abu Dhabi. See full address and map.
Categories: Plants - Indoor
Camelia Flowers
Camelia Flowers
Address: Al Khalidiya, Abu DhabiLandmark: Behind Grand Store, Abu Dhabi. See full address and map.
Categories: Plants - Indoor